--- Comment #1 from Kurt Borja (kuurtb@gmail.com) ---
Hi Dmytro,

(In reply to Dmytro Bagrii from comment #0)
> Mic Mute key (Fn+F4) stopped to emit input events. 
> Before v6.15 pressing Fn+F4 caused `libinput debug-events` to print:
> 
> -event8   KEYBOARD_KEY                 +21.508s KEY_MICMUTE (248) pressed
>  event8   KEYBOARD_KEY                 +21.508s KEY_MICMUTE (248) released

Can you please check which device owns this input event?

It may change from boot to boot so call debug-events again, press the mic mute
key, check the event number and get it's parent's name with

$ libinput list-devices

Additionally, please attach the output of this command before and after the
regression.
